Russ Allbery <rra at Stanford.EDU> writes:
> Jeffrey M Vinocur <jeff at> writes:

>> I finally got a chance to pursue this a bit.  I definitely don't know
>> how widespread the necessary compiler support is.

> It's required by POSIX, I believe (I'll check when I get to work), so it
> should be getting more widespread.

It isn't.  *mutter*

  -o outfile
      Use the pathname outfile, instead of the default a.out, for the
      executable file produced. If the -o option is present with -c or -E,
      the result is unspecified.

Why POSIX still hasn't considered this worth standardizing is really
beyond me.

